Q.Is My Stapelia Vellitiae Ok?

Zone 3777 | Anonymous added on July 13, 2021 | Answered

I bought this stapelia vellitiae about a year ago and may have neglected it. Took a photo and showed a nursery and it had millie bugs. I was given a spray to get rid of them and seemed to work. Has a couple white stains on it still. I cut the tops of as they appeared rotten. I’ve re potted in premium potting mix advised by the nursery as it works similar to succulent mix. I have a new healthy looking shoot growing right under the bigger shoot.

It looks to be suffering from the infestation. I would apply a fungicide to mitigate any infection brought about by the insects. Recovery can take awhile, but with proper care will happen.

You can treat this like its close relative, the starfish cactus.
